    Journal: American Journal of Translational Research

    Article Title: miR-370 impacts the biological behavior of lung cancer cells by targeting the SMAD1 signaling pathway

    doi:

    Figure Lengend Snippet: Targeting association between miR-370 and SMAD1. A. Prediction of targets of miR-370 by Targetscan and miRDB. B. Analysis of SMAD1 expression in NSCLC by TCGA and GTEx. C. Detection of SMAD1 expression in LC cell lines by RT-qPCR and western blot. D. Analysis of the targeting association between miR-370 and SMAD1 by DLR assay. Note: miR: MicroRNA; LC: Lung Cancer; RT-qPCR: Real-time Fluorescence Quantitative Polymerase Chain Reaction; SMAD1: SMAD Family Member 1; DLR: Dual Luciferase Reporter; WT: Wild Type; MUT: Mutant; WB: western blot, ***P<0.001, ****P<0.0001.

    Article Snippet: After 48 h of transfection, the luciferase activity was determined through a DLR gene detection kit (Promega, Madison, WI, the States) following the corresponding protocol.
